Ogdahl, Harmon T. Age 91 of Mpls passed away November 8, 2009. Son of Inez and Henry. He served in the U.S. Army from 1942 to 1946. Harmon worked in real estate and founded DAO Corporation with his wife Dawn building homes in the Twin Cities for low-income people. He served in the Minnesota State Senate from 1962 to 1981 and was President of Union State Bank until retiring in 1983. He was preceded in death by parents, wives Dawn and Beverly, son Gary and brother Lowell. He is survived by his children, Sally (Ron) Friestad, Susan (Chris) Ankeny, Laurie (Jay) Hall, Harmon Ogdahl Jr.; daughter-in- law, Carol Ogdahl; 12 grandchildren and 15 great-grandchildren; and sisters, Shirley and Delores.
